T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S 

Name 

PIEPS iPROBE BT 220 | 260 | 300 

Transmission frequency 

457 kHz 

Bluetooth transmission frequency 

2.402 - 2.480 GHz 

Bluetooth transmission power 

0 dBm 

Probe length total 

220 cm | 260 cm | 300 cm 

Probe pack length 

47,6 cm 

Weight incl. battery 

380 g | 420 g | 460 g 

Power supply 

1x Alkaline, AA, LR6, 1,5V 

Battery lifetime 

100 h 

Temperature range 

-20° C to +45° C (-4° F to +113° F) 

Approaching range 

2 m 

Targeting range 

approx. 50 to 0 cm 

Probing length (mechanical) 

220 cm | 260 cm | 300 cm 

Probing length (mech electronical) 

270 cm | 310 cm | 350 cm

SIGNAL WORDS USED IN THE S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S 

 

DANGER

 

Imminent threat to the life of individuals 

A safety instruction with the signal word DANGER indicates an imminent threat to the life and 
health of individuals! 

 

WARNING

 

Risk of personal injury (serious injuries) and possible material damage 

A safety instruction with the signal word WARNING indicates a dangerous situation which 
could affect the health of individuals. 

 

CAUTION

 

Risk of material damage and possible minor risk of injury 

A safety instruction with the signal word CAUTION indicates a possibly dangerous situation 
which could primarily result in material damage. 

NOTICE

 

This symbol with the text NOTICE indicates supporting information.
